Output 0752dd637a22bc49e988a7d94a574d5e699a2d5819c749197d35dcc6daedce2a:0

value
22637432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3b8640f1e7114513f20a1776ba78b3e97bf244 OP_EQUAL
address
35uUKCRV3WLDorxHpWcxsdaEbQs4iB3Y4M
transaction
0752dd637a22bc49e988a7d94a574d5e699a2d5819c749197d35dcc6daedce2a
confirmations
456254
spent
true